Brides with Ink


Today, one in every eight people in the United States has a tattoo. That means, a lot of people with tattoos get married every year! Lately I've been noticing a trend... let's call it "ink couture". Modern brides not only have tattoos, but incorporate them into the overall look for their weddings! I love that! It's art! How could I not?

Some people decide to cover their tattoos by airbrushing. However! I think that if you liked something enough to get it permanently placed on your body, then you should show it off on your wedding day! Find a dress that accents the tattoo, or makes it a part of the overall bridal look. Here are some women who are not afraid to flaunt their ink on their wedding day... couture style!
